The price action remains contained within a well-defined range, with support holding at $170.26 and resistance near $188.18. Trading volume over the past few weeks has been largely in line with historical averages, suggesting a lack of conviction among buyers or sellers as the stock consolidates near the middle of its recent range. Within the broader technology and consulting sectors, Accenture continues to be viewed as a bellwether for enterprise spending on digital transformation and AI-related services. Recent commentary from industry peers has highlighted sustained demand for cloud migration and automation, themes that would likely benefit Accenture’s consulting and outsourcing segments. However, macroeconomic uncertainty—particularly around interest rate expectations and corporate budget tightening—has kept some investors on the sidelines. Technical indicators show the stock is neither overbought nor oversold, with momentum oscillating in neutral territory. The recent price stability may reflect a wait-and-see approach ahead of clearer signals from the Federal Reserve and upcoming client spending decisions. The company’s strong positioning in AI and data analytics continues to be a key factor supporting longer-term investor interest, though near-term catalysts remain tied to broader market sentiment and corporate IT spending trends. The stock has recently found buying interest near the $170.26 support zone, a level that has historically acted as a pivot point during pullbacks. On the upside, the $188.18 resistance area remains a key hurdle; the stock briefly approached this zone in recent weeks but failed to sustain momentum, suggesting sellers remain active at these levels. From a trend perspective, the broader price action has formed a series of lower highs since the start of the year, hinting at a potential downtrend or consolidation phase. Volume during the latest rebound has been modest—neither confirming a breakout nor signaling exhaustion. Momentum indicators have moved into neutral territory, with the Relative Strength Index hovering in the mid‑40s, indicating a lack of strong directional conviction. Meanwhile, the stock is trading just below its 50‑day moving average, a level that often serves as an initial test of near‑term trend strength. A consolidation pattern appears to be developing, with price oscillating between the $170 area and the $188 resistance. A sustained move above the latter would likely require a clear catalyst and above‑average volume; conversely, a breakdown below support could expose the next demand zone in the mid‑$160s. Traders may watch for a decisive close either side of these boundaries to gauge the next directional bias. The identified support at $170.26 and resistance at $188.18 provide a framework for potential scenarios. A sustained move above resistance could signal renewed investor confidence, possibly driven by strength in consulting and digital transformation demand; conversely, a break below support might invite further downside testing, particularly if macroeconomic headwinds weigh on enterprise spending. Several factors could influence which path unfolds. Client budgets for technology consulting remain sensitive to interest rate expectations and corporate earnings trends, both of which are subject to change. The company’s ability to execute on managed services and AI-related engagements may serve as a differentiator. Additionally, currency fluctuations and geopolitical uncertainties could impact Accenture’s global revenue mix. The upcoming earnings release—expected in the near term—will likely provide clarity on revenue trends, margins, and management’s forward-looking commentary. Until then, the stock may remain range-bound, with trading volume offering clues about conviction behind any breakout or breakdown.
